Flotation modelling to date has concentrated either on macroscale processes or on ideal microscale processes - there has been no attempt to integrate detailed models at different scales. In this paper, bubble-particle collision efficiency with mobile bubble Surfaces in a turbulent flow is investigated from a multiscale modelling viewpoint and a general methodology for modelling is present. Comparisons are carried out to illustrate the method. Turbulence effects on bubble-particle collision efficiency are systematically studied using a 3D k-epsilon turbulence model.
